Apply NowThe General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M) is the diploma programme that can be pursued after the completion of 10+2. The course specifically trains the students with the relevant skills of maternity and child care.
The students will be given the training to treat pregnant mothers and newborns. The GNM course aims to qualify students into professional and qualified nurses and empower them to work as a part of the medical fraternity.
The course gives exclusive training on various nursing practices to the students and also trains them to treat the patients with care and affection.
The course develops the students into responsible nurses and enables them to serve in the field of medicine by abiding by the principles and ethics of nursing.
The GNM course is affiliated to Karnataka State Diploma in Nursing Examination Board. The course follows the syllabus prescribed by Indian Nursing Council (INC).
1st Year | 2nd Year | 3rd Year |
---|---|---|
Biosciences: Anatomy & Physiology & Microbiology | Medical-Surgical Nursing – I (Pharmacology) | Medical-Surgical Nursing – I (Pharmacology) |
Behavioural Sciences: Psychology & Sociology | Medical-Surgical Nursing – II (Specialities) | Paediatric Nursing |
Fundamentals of Nursing | Mental Health and Psychiatric Nursing | Community Health Nursing – II |
Community Health Nursing- I | Practical Nursing – I Medical-Surgical Nursing | Practical – II Paediatric Nursing |
Practical - I | Practical – II Psychiatric Nursing | Practical – II Paediatric Nursing |
Practical – III Community Health Nursing- II |
The requirement for nurses is huge across the globe. The increased life span of people has created a huge demand for nursing students globally. The GNM students have ample job opportunities in both government and private health care Institutions.
The GNM students who are interested to study further can apply for higher studies such as B.Sc. Nursing,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ing, M.Sc. Nursing, Ph.D. in Nursing.

The average salary package for GNM students is around Rs. 2 lakhs to Rs. 5 lakhs per annum. The average GNM fresher will be earning about Rs. 2 Lakhs per annum and the salary varies according to experience and skills gained.
